Rowe, 8456 (DCM)

The following text is a Distinguished Conduct Medal (DCM) transcription of a Border Regiment soldier of the First World War.
Name J. Rowe
Rank Sergeant
Number 8456
Other details 1st Border Regiment (St. Pancras)
Date published 3 September 1919
Citation For gallantry and devotion to duty during the period 25th Feb. to 17th September 1918. He has commanded a platoon or been acting CSM during this period. He has at all times, when under fire, shown great gallantry and set a very fine example to the men, especially during the Lys and Outtersteene battles. His work throughout has been of a very high standard.
